First Major Election In Kashmir Since India Revoked Article 370 In 2019
An Indian soldier is guarding the street while women voters are queuing to cast their votes during the fourth phase of voting in India's general election in Srinagar, Kashmir, India, on May 13, 2024. This election marks the first major election in Kashmir since India revoked Article 370 of its constitution in 2019, which granted Kashmir autonomy. (Photo by Faisal Khan/NurPhoto)
